Ranking of Utah Counties By Percentage of Population with Croatian Ancestry in 2021

Updated on April 16, 2025.

Based on the US Census ACS-5Yrs estimates, in 2021, there were 3.43K people in Utah with Croatian ancestry (0.11% of Utah population). Among all Utah counties, Davis County had the highest percentage of its population with Croatian ancestry (0.24%), followed by Sanpete County (0.18%), and Carbon County (0.17%).

Rank County Percentage of Pop. (%)
1 Davis County 0.24
2 Sanpete County 0.18
3 Carbon County 0.17
4 Salt Lake County 0.14
5 Washington County 0.10
6 Summit County 0.09
7 Utah County 0.07
8 Wasatch County 0.06
9 Weber County 0.05
10 Cache County 0.03
11 Duchesne County 0.02
11 Iron County 0.02
12 Box Elder County 0.01
12 Emery County 0.01
